#c6b7e7 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c6b7e7 is composed of 77.6% red, 71.8% green and 90.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 14.3% cyan, 20.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 9.4% black. It has a hue angle of 258.8 degrees, a saturation of 50% and a lightness of 81.2%. #c6b7e7 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#8d6fcf. Closest websafe color is: #ccccff.

Shades and Tints of #c6b7e7

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010102 is the darkest color, while #f5f2f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#c6b7e7

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#cecdd1 is the less saturated color, while #bea1fd is the most saturated one.
